Unless this '88 5-oh is a California car, it's running speed density.
So if you want to use an aftermarket cam, you'll have convert to
mass-air, or suffer an idle that hunts. Trust me... with the cam
you'll want to switch to mass-air.
Roller-rockers, while not a big HP maker, are always a good idea.
